  2. Self-archiving refers to the practice of making a version of a published work available in an open repository, such as an institutional database or personal website12345. It allows authors to provide free access to their research, even when the publisher version is not freely available.

    What is self-archiving? The author, institution or publisher places a version of a subscription article in an online repository and/or website.* The submitted version of the article can be self-archived immediately. The accepted version of the article can be self-archived after an embargo period.

    Self-archiving is the act of (the author's) depositing a free copy of an electronic document online in order to provide open access to it. The term usually refers to the self-archiving of peer-reviewed research journal and conference articles, as well as theses and book chapters, deposited in the author's own … See more
